Hydrogen Technologies Inc
HTI has patented a revolutionary method for burning hydrogen and oxygen in a vacuum chamber to create heat and water with no greenhouse gases.
HTI is a small group of seasoned professionals in the process of deploying the first commercial units in North America.

A hydrogen powered steam boiler for Combined Heat and Power (CHP) producing only heat and water without GHG emissions.
The Dynamic Combustion Chamber™ or hydrogen boiler is powered by stored hydrogen made from renewable energy sources that emits zero greenhouse gases.
Dynamic Combustion Chamber (TM)
Description
A steam boiler using hydrogen as it's fuel in a pure oxygen environment producing only heat and water.
This boiler uses hydrogen and oxygen from renewable energy and electrolysis to produce heat and water without generating any air pollutants. No smokestack or any other energy dissipating exhaust, and is nearly 30% more efficient in fuel usage than a typical conventional steam boiler. The DCC (TM) can be used for hot water, steam or Combined Heat and Power (CHP) applications in industrial and commercial applications for space conditioning, water and wastewater treatment, food processing, process steam generation or enhanced oil recovery.
